From: SMTP%"vladimir.cindro@ijs.si" 28-OCT-1997 23:12:22.46 To: Andrew Nichols , Marko Mikuz , tony smith , Erik Margan , Carl Haber , nobu unno , Tim Jones , gfmoor@axnd02.cern.ch Subj: low mass bending radius We have got first samples of low mass tapes (cables) . Aluminum thickness is 50 microns, kapton thickness is 25 microns (in single layer). Cables are about 1.6 m long. First tests have shown that bending radius of these cables may be less than 1 cm. We intend to make a second iteration with a design of lines defined on http://merlot.ijs.si/atlas/low_mass.html. We expect to produce and deliver in the next iteration about 10 cables for forward tests (delivery to Tony Smith) and about same for barrell (delivery to Gareth Moorehead). Cables will be suited for MOLEX 20 pin connectors.
